    Hi Gypsy I worked on this quilt for three months .The peacock and flowers are all machine quilted and FMQ roses on pink border that was a lot of fun ,it was my first time doing that. I have a new machine, so this quilt let me use all the new bells and whistles Including embroidery module.The room I made Moms quilt for has oriental things in it.I was able to find a usb stick from the OESD company full of beautiful designs I used them on blue border and yellow border and made shams that match.thanks for looking
